Software Technology

Autodesk’s suite of simulation and analysis software, including Inventor Nastran®, Autodesk CFD, Moldflow, and Robot Structural Analysis, offers comprehensive tools designed to enhance product performance, sustainability, and manufacturability across various industries. These products enable engineers to accurately predict product behavior under real-world conditions, streamline the design process, and achieve optimized solutions efficiently, empowering innovation and excellence in product development.
